T-shirts Reincarnated

I used some of John's old black and white T-shirts to crochet this bathroom rug last week. The jersey knit fabric is perfect for a bathroom rug...it's soft and cushy beneath bare feet...and of course it's a great place for a napping beagle!

I discovered how to prep the old T-shirts for crochet on my favorite crochet blog, Laughing Purple Goldfish. Believe it or not, this rug only took a few days to complete and I love that it is a reincarnation of John's old T-shirts!

Georgie's New Sweater

Mid January was REALLY cold in New York...colder than Georgie and I are used to. I noticed all the other dogs in the nieghborhood wearing sweaters and coats and felt bad that I didn't have anything for Georgie to wear but her raincoat (which actually is pretty good when it's snowing). John and I did actually buy her a little coat, but when we brought it home, it didn't fit her round little belly. So, I decided to try crocheting her a sweater, something I've never made before, and surprisingly, it came out pretty cute!
